RPA Developer
Key Responsibilities
- Design, build, and deploy RPA bots using Automation Anywhere to automate repetitive daily/weekly tasks, such as data entry, report generation, and transaction processing [info 10].
- Map end-to-end process logic, identify technical requirements, and ensure bot workflows complete transactions accurately (e.g., validating inputs, handling exceptions) [info 8].
- Implement DevOps practices for bot deployment, including CI/CD pipelines, to streamline updates and maintain bot reliability [info 15].

RPA Architect
Key Responsibilities
- Define enterprise-wide technical standards, best practices, and governance models for automation projects to ensure consistency and scalability [info 3].
- Collaborate with business stakeholders (e.g., operations, IT) to translate requirements into secure, reliable RPA solutions that align with organizational goals [info 3, 20].
- Create detailed architectural diagrams, technical documentation, and optimize existing automation workflows to resolve production issues and improve efficiency [info 9].
RPA Developer vs. RPA Architect: Key Differences
| Role | Primary Focus | Key Deliverables | Required Expertise |
|---|---|---|---|
| RPA Developer | Hands-on bot development | Daily/weekly bots, process logic scripts | Automation Anywhere, basic DevOps, process mapping |
| RPA Architect | Strategic solution design | Governance frameworks, scalability plans | Process mining, security standards, enterprise architecture |
Key Takeaways:
- RPA Developers focus on executing automation at the task level, while RPA Architects design the foundation for scalable, enterprise-wide automation.

Process Mining Tools
68% of organizations report accelerated automation initiatives after implementing process mining tools, according to a 2023 McKinsey Global Survey on Business Automation. These tools act as a "process X-ray," revealing hidden inefficiencies and high-impact automation opportunities that drive productivity gains, cost reduction, and faster service delivery.
Identification of High-Impact Automation Opportunities
Data-Driven Visibility into Process Flows
Process mining tools eliminate guesswork by providing end-to-end visibility into how processes actually run—not just how they’re supposed to run. By analyzing event logs from ERP, CRM, and other systems, these tools map process flows, highlight bottlenecks, and flag deviations (e.g., manual workarounds or redundant steps).
Practical Example: A manufacturing firm used process mining to analyze its order-to-fulfillment process. The tool uncovered that 32% of orders required manual intervention due to inconsistent data entry—an opportunity for RPA automation.
Pro Tip: Start with high-volume processes (e.g., invoice processing, customer onboarding) to maximize early ROI. Map at least 3 months of historical data to account for seasonal variations.

Integration with RPA and Complementary Technologies
The true power of process mining lies in its ability to seamlessly connect with RPA tools like UiPath and Automation Anywhere. These integrations allow organizations to transition from "identifying opportunities" to "deploying bots" in days, not months.
Technical Checklist: Process Mining-RPA Integration
- Validate process maps with RPA developers to ensure technical feasibility.
- Use APIs to sync process mining data with RPA platforms for real-time monitoring.
- Test bots on prioritized processes (e.g., data entry, report generation) before full-scale deployment.
Top-performing solutions include Celonis, UiPath Process Mining, and Minit—each offering pre-built connectors for leading RPA tools.
